New Zealand singer Lorde is known for her quirky fashion sense.

But on Wednesday, the popstar (born Ella Yelich-O'Connor) opted for a polished look as she stepped out to attend Christian Dior's Designer of Dreams Exhibition in Brooklyn, New York.

The 24-year-old showed off a hint of her cleavage as she donned a black baby-doll style gown.

In the interview which accompanied the stunning photoshoot, the talented songwriter shared her discomfort with 'the pop star life.' 

'I'm great at my job, but I'm not sure I'm the man for the job,' she mused. 'I'm a highly sensitive person. I'm not built for pop star life.

'To have a public-facing existence is something I find really intense and is something I'm not good at,' she admitted. 'That natural charisma is not what I have. I have the brain in the jar.' 

Lorde's newest album, Solar Power is her first project to be recorded in the Māori language and it's out now.
